KATHMANDU, March 22 -- Minister for Foreign Affairs Pradeep Kumar Gyawali has said that all forms of international cooperation should respect national ownership and leadership, and focus on the needs and priorities of the country.

Addressing the Second High-Level United Nations Conference on South-South Cooperation in Buenos Aires, Argentina on Wednesday, Minister Gyawali said that his statement is based on the experience of Nepal's own development process.

According to Minister Gyawali, the principle of 'leaving no one behind' should be placed at the core as some members of the global south are lagging far behind despite having similar ambitions for development.
